Output 708406fe658267a495e9607e6fe53771ee83a2525439080f63ee8101f83aa347:1

value
25140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d9091e111c2add1fecfa4a74d49cc1338019ee OP_EQUAL
address
A4urZNrRfaNAGRfMLq2rsQgwyu7PAhfqj6
transaction
708406fe658267a495e9607e6fe53771ee83a2525439080f63ee8101f83aa347